Text

No limited partnership is eligible to receive a license to own a gambling enterprise unless the conduct of gambling is among the purposes stated in the certificate of limited partnership.

Legislative History

Added by renumbering Section 19881 by Stats. 2002, Ch. 738, Sec. 70. Effective January 1, 2003.
